After 9-year chase, Jagsir Singh, known by his stage name Baaz Sran, was arrested this week by the Narcotics Control Bureau (NCB) in Haryana. The popular Punjabi singer was wanted in a major drug case linked to the seizure of over 36 kg of opium. He had been declared a proclaimed offender in 2016. Not only did Sran avoid arrest by constantly changing his name and location, but he also did so while gaining fame and over 33,000 followers on Instagram and YouTube. With his real identity hidden, the singer became popular for tracks like Kare Rabb Khair, Sarkari Kothi, Tera Darji, Loaded Yaar, Asla, and Gal Ni Bani. Now he faces legal action for his role in the narcotics case, bringing an end to one of the longest manhunts by the NCB in recent years.
